California Bank Failure “Isolated”

The takeover of the Silicon Valley Bank in California by the federal government is an isolated incident.
South Dakota Congressman Dusty Johnson says it appears to be a bad management problem….

Johnson says its unfortunate that it turned into a partisan issue…

Johnson says there was no widespread change in banking regulations….

The President and the Federal Reserve said that all depositors would get their money out of the failed bank.
Johnson was a guest on “Drivetime with Von and Steve on 570 WNAX.”
